What is the Greatest Common Factor (GCF)?
The Greatest Common Factor (GCF) is the largest positive integer that divides all given numbers exactly.
It is also commonly called:
- Highest Common Factor (HCF)
- Greatest Common Divisor (GCD)
Example:
Numbers:
24 and 36
Factors of 24:
1, 2, 3, 4, 6, 8, 12, 24
Factors of 36:
1, 2, 3, 4, 6, 9, 12, 18, 36
Common Factors:
1, 2, 3, 4, 6, 12
Greatest Common Factor = 12

Formula for Finding the Greatest Common Factor
There is no single arithmetic formula for finding the GCF, but several standard mathematical methods are used.
Method 1: Prime Factorization
Step 1
Write each number as a product of prime factors.
Example:
24 = 2³ × 3
36 = 2² × 3²
60 = 2² × 3 × 5
Step 2
Select the common prime factors with the smallest exponent.
Common:
2² × 3
Step 3
Multiply them.
4 × 3 = 12
Therefore,
GCF = 12
Method 2: Euclidean Algorithm
For two numbers:
If:
a > b
Then repeatedly calculate:
GCF(a, b) = GCF(b, a mod b)
Continue until the remainder becomes 0.
The last non-zero divisor is the GCF.
This algorithm is highly efficient for large numbers.
Example 1
Find the GCF of:
18 and 30
Factors of 18:
1, 2, 3, 6, 9, 18
Factors of 30:
1, 2, 3, 5, 6, 10, 15, 30
Common Factors:
1, 2, 3, 6
Greatest Common Factor:
6
Example 2
Find the GCF of:
48, 72, and 96
Prime Factorization:
48 = 2⁴ × 3
72 = 2³ × 3²
96 = 2⁵ × 3
Common Factors:
2³ × 3
GCF:
8 × 3
= 24
